| | cmd window, can't run any programs, access is denied Hi, I think I've done something to my computer, but I'm not sure what. I can no longer execute any command line programs from a cmd window. I get "Access is denied". That applies to find, more, help, etc., everything, including cmd itself, which should open up another window. I have no trouble starting a cmd window from the Start menu, though. And if I type "more" in the Start menu I get a window with more.com in the title. It's just that nothing works from a cmd window itself. Desperate for any ideas. Thanks. rd |
